APEC Open Skies Pact In Force; Peru, Pacific States May Join
New Zealand last month completed its ratification of the Asia Pacific Economic Cooperation-based multilateral open-skies agreement, bringing the accord into force. The APEC multilateral, agreed to in November 2000 by Brunei, Chile, New Zealand, Singapore and the U.S., which jointly signed the...
